It was very easy paper and very difficult one at the same time.....In my opinion , it was a very good paper from subjective point of view..... You were given the chance to express your opinion. Now, it matters how much your opinion carries weight and how strong points you have to prove your point. In my opinion the most important thing is that you should have practical approach, basic principles knowledge and ability to convince others with your arguments. I may be wrong but this is how i take this subject. I have taken this exam and finally i have come to the conclusion that it was not that easy as people think or saying. I know everyone was able to attend four questions because questions were so general but the difference of content and quality, originality and practicality, and approach towards things will be the key factors in getting good marks.

I would recommend people to read from good books, try to look things critically and what ever is your opinion you should be able to convince the people with your arguments.
